Volkswagen India has introduced the Virtus Anniversary Edition, a limited-volume special edition celebrating the success of the Virtus premium sedan in the Indian market. Based on the Virtus GT Plus Sport, the Anniversary Edition brings exclusive styling updates while retaining the sedan’s renowned blend of performance, safety and German engineering.

The highlight of the special edition is the introduction of an exclusive Avocado Pearl exterior finish, paired with a contrasting black roof and black alloy wheels, giving the Virtus a more distinctive and sporty appearance.

Speaking on the launch, Nitin Kohli, Brand Director, Volkswagen India, said the Anniversary Edition celebrates the strong customer response the Virtus has received since its introduction and further enhances its desirability with the exclusive new colour.

The Virtus GT Plus Sport continues to offer a premium feature list, including a 20.32 cm Digital Cockpit, electric sunroof, Laser Red ambient lighting, aluminium pedals, automatic headlights, rain-sensing wipers and an auto-dimming IRVM.

Under the bonnet is Volkswagen’s 1.5-litre TSI EVO turbo-petrol engine, producing 150 PS and 250 Nm of torque, paired with a 7-speed DSG automatic transmission for an engaging driving experience.

Safety remains a strong point, with the Virtus offering six airbags as standard, a 5-star Global NCAP safety rating, and more than 40 advanced safety features.

Volkswagen is also offering customers the option to fit genuine accessories, including a 360-degree camera, front parking sensors, and puddle lamps, through authorised dealerships for both the Virtus and Taigun.

The Volkswagen Virtus Anniversary Edition is priced at ₹19.19 lakh (ex-showroom) and will be available in limited numbers across Volkswagen dealerships in India.
